Output ec3f8728f7a3fb7aedc28b4186f61b5de1e41d11d6d7818d2f6fdd2e5ae38378:0

value
2660848
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bdfd4a621b1e221fadfae7836891097ea613ffe OP_EQUALVERIFY OP_CHECKSIG
address
1Dkb4h6dRto5GFSRFdqDVVL7eD4XKhFhxo
transaction
ec3f8728f7a3fb7aedc28b4186f61b5de1e41d11d6d7818d2f6fdd2e5ae38378
spent
true